Come see this charming 5 bed, 3 bath home located in a quiet east side Heber neighborhood. Enjoy summer BBQ's and outdoor living in the fully landscaped yard and fenced backyard, and a in-ground trampoline. Inside you will find enough room for the whole family. The master bedroom boasts a large vaulted ceiling, walk-in closet, and a bathroom complete with a large jetted tub. There's also plenty of off street RV parking and additional garage storage. This house has been well maintained and is ready to move in.

R-1
Residential Zone
The objective in establishing the R-1 residential zone is to encourage the creation and maintenance of residential areas within the city which are characterized by large lots on which single-family dwellings are situated, surrounded by well-kept lawns, trees and other plantings. A minimum of vehicular and pedestrian traffic and quiet residential conditions.
